What Are the Popular Fall Flowers?

Fall bouquets often feature a mix of classic and contemporary flowers that thrive during this season. Chrysanthemums, with their vibrant colors and sturdy petals, are a staple in many fall arrangements. Sunflowers, with their cheerful disposition, add a touch of warmth. Roses, in shades of deep red and burgundy, evoke a sense of elegance and sophistication. Additionally, ornamental grasses and berries can be incorporated to enhance the rustic feel of the bouquets.

How Do Florists Create Fall Bouquets?

Plymouth florists are adept at creating bouquets that reflect the season's spirit. They carefully select flowers and foliage that complement each other in color and texture. The arrangement is often more relaxed and natural, mimicking the wild beauty of autumn landscapes. Florists also consider the vase or container, choosing ones that enhance the overall aesthetic of the bouquet. The result is a harmonious blend of elements that celebrates the fall season.

How Can You Maintain the Freshness of Fall Bouquets?

To ensure that your fall bouquet remains fresh and vibrant, it is important to follow a few simple care tips. Regularly trim the stems and change the water to prevent bacteria buildup. Keep the bouquet away from direct sunlight and heat sources, as these can cause the flowers to wilt prematurely. Additionally, you can add a floral preservative to the water to extend the life of the bouquet.
